Digital and Technology Solutions Degree Apprenticeship Our Digital & Technology Solutions Degree Apprenticeships are aimed at people who have a passion for learning and innovation. As a Digital & Technology Solutions Degree Apprentice, you will implement technology solutions aligned to your pathway, to develop new products and services and increase productivity using digital technologies. As an apprentice, you will develop the Knowledge, Skills, and Behaviours (KSBs) outlined in the apprenticeship standard. These will be assessed during your End Point Assessment (EPA), where you will demonstrate the competencies and skills you've gained throughout the programme. Software Engineering pathway This pathway will show you how to design, build and test ground-breaking software. You'll also learn how to integrate engineering principles that deliver superior analysis, development and built-in security. Along the way, you could work in any of the following functional areas: Engineering Body Chassis (EBC), Digital Products Platform (DPP), Engineering Propulsion (EP) or Engineering Operations (EO). To apply you'll need to have achieved GCSE Maths and English Language at level 5 (C) or higher. You'll also need three additional GCSEs at level 5 (C) or higher, to include one STEM (science, technology, engineering or maths) subject. In addition, you will need to have achieved or be on track to achieve A-level Maths at grade C or higher and an additional A-level in Physics, Chemistry, Design & Technology, ICT, Computer Science, Economics or Engineering at grade C or higher. As an E-Machine Adhesive SME, you will lead the application and development of adhesives and formed-in-place materials used in powertrain e-machine applications. Your expertise will ensure the quality and performance of critical bonding solutions-such as lamination stack adhesives, magnet bonding, wire lacquers, potting compounds, and thermal interface materials-meet design intent requirements. Working closely with cross-functional teams across Product Design, Prototype & Production Manufacturing, and Material Engineering, you will play a key role in shaping the future of electric propulsion systems. Key Accountabilities and Responsibilities: Failure Mode Avoidance - Develop and maintain DFMEAs for adhesive applications, ensuring robust designs from the outset. Technical Leadership - Own and update engineering standards, design rules, and validation procedures for adhesives and formed-in-place materials. Issue Prevention & Resolution - Lead root cause investigations (8D/DMAIC), capture lessons learned and embed improvements in foundation documentation. Mentorship & Guidance - Coach component engineers in assessing bonded interfaces and support programme teams with technical compliance at key milestones. Benchmarking & Best Practices - Analyse competitor solutions, collaborate with supplier technical specialists, and develop teardown analysis guidelines for adhesive performance assessments. WHAT TO EXPECT This will be a highly specialised and strategic role providing complex privacy advice and support to many parts of the JLR business globally on current and emerging personal data and privacy compliance matters. This role will have particular focus on strategic projects' privacy risk assessments and Data Protection Impact Assessments (DPIAs) fully integrated into our company's aspirations to delight our customers with a Modern Luxury experience in mobility services. The role will support key functions and projects as they look to expand sensitive and complex data handling activities in particular under the Attract & Retain value creation stream. The role will also serve as Deputy DPO. THE ROLE Key Responsibilities: Providing thought leadership into JLR Privacy Compliance programme and acting as Deputy DPO. Supporting and influencing our Business Functions' strategy on privacy-related matters for key projects, particularly as regards new strategic projects and connected services. Acting as lead data protection advisor to key data handling initiatives under Attract & Retain VCS, providing pragmatic advice on complex compliance requirements. Advising on project risk assessments and privacy impact assessments (PIAs) on relevant data processing systems. Occasionally supporting the drafting of and advising on corporate policies, procedures and guidelines on JLR's use of personal information. Advising on complex cross-border data transfer compliance requirements including drafting and providing key legal advice on privacy matters. Providing appropriate guidance, education, training, and regular communications on privacy compliance to relevant employees, including delivering data protection training to relevant business functions and participating in awareness programmes. Promoting and developing a culture of doing business in the right way; driving continuous improvement of compliance practices; and working alongside key stakeholders within the company to advise and support on privacy compliance related matters.
